Transaction 21dea0f21052823b7e81cff37907266004a15c80d6084496002a6f2667a81e3a
1 Input
1 Output
-
21dea0f21052823b7e81cff37907266004a15c80d6084496002a6f2667a81e3a:0
- value
- 1000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ea5731857a7995ac1a263015a0117630343951a03e3b0a4e3521266dadbfcefd
- address
- bc1paftnrpt60x26cx3xxq26qytkxq6rj5dq8cas5n34yynxmtdlem7shyjgrk